Representative Engagements

The practice is grounded in operating experience across company formation, synthetic biology, AI-native diagnostics, translational medicine, first-in-human development, organizational design, commercialization, and acquisition.

MultiOmics

MultiOmics is an AI-native precision-diagnostics company focused on early breast-cancer detection.

Michael's role
Interim CSO/CBO through Attenuated Technologies. Michael leads scientific development, operating coordination, corporate strategy, business-development support, and AI strategy.
Outcome
Selected for the 2025 C10/LabCentral AI-BioHub cohort. Michael created the application and pitch materials used during the program.

Brahma Therapeutics

Brahma Therapeutics was formed around a de novo peptide-engineering platform and the opportunity to translate foundational academic technologies into a biotechnology company.

Michael's role
Founder & Chief Scientist. Michael negotiated foundational licenses, defined the platform and development strategy, and built the scientific operation from concept through proof of concept.
Outcome
Brahma was positioned for and reached a strategic acquisition outcome in May 2023.

CREATE Medicines / Myeloid Therapeutics

CREATE Medicines, formerly Myeloid Therapeutics, is a clinical-stage biotechnology company advancing in vivo CAR programs through first-in-human development.

Michael's role
Senior Director, Translational Science. Michael led biomarker strategy and translational execution for MT302 and directed cross-functional startup of multinational Phase I program MT303.
Outcome
Michael's translational work supported full enrollment of MT302 in under 12 months. MT303 expanded the clinical pipeline and international operating footprint.

SEngine Precision Medicine

SEngine developed a functional precision-oncology platform intended to move from assay development into a CLIA-certified clinical diagnostic service.

Michael's role
Lead Scientist, then Principal Scientist. Michael built the CLIA-certified P.A.R.I.S. test and later supported its physician-facing clinical implementation and broader company development.
Outcome
Michael developed personalized drug panels for more than 100 cancer patients and supported an approximately $9 million financing through financial analysis, valuation work, diligence materials, and company presentations. The CEO led the financing.
